Previous Winner's List:

2010 The Legend Of Koizumi
2009 Eden Of The East
2008 Michiko To Hatchin
2007 The Girl Who Leapt Through Time
2006 The Melancholy of Haruhi Suzumiya
2005 Genshiken
2004 Paranoia Agent
2003 Full Metal Panic? Fumoffu
2002 Azumanga Diaoh
2001 Trigun
2000 Cowboy Bebop
1999 Rurouni Kenshin
1998 Rurouni Kenshin
1997 Vision of Escaflowne
1996 Whisper of the Heart

Wooden Spooner's List:

2010 Dogs
2009 Soul Eater
2008 Mobile Suit Gundam 00
2007 Hanoka
2006 Popotan
2005 Green Green
2004 Super Radical Gag Family
2003 Samurai Deeper Kyo
2002 Earth Girl Arjuna
2001 The Legend of the Galactic Heroes
2000 Fancy Lala
1999 Gundam Wing
1998 Roots Search
1997 Roots Search
1996 Roots Search
